Mustangs finish 3-1 at Chicago tourney

CHICAGO - The Mount Mercy University volleyball team finished with a 3-1 record at the Chicago State Tournament after splitting two matches Saturday.

The Mustangs defeated Purdue North Central, 25-12, 25-14, 25-12, and lost to Chicago State, 25-18, 24-26, 25-23, 25-13.

Megan Paustian had nine kills against Purdue North Central. Lori Peterzalek had 14 digs and seven kills. Demi Heiss contributed seven kills. Abbie Perez collected 19 assists and Leslie Hoffmann had eight blocked shots.

Paustian and Heiss finished with 10 kills against Chicago State. Perez had 23 assists, Samantha Meyer had 20 digs, Emily Hendrickson pitched in with 12 assists and Hannah Whitley had 10 digs.

Mount Mercy (6-0) won both of its matches at the tournament Friday.

Mustang spikers win twice in Chicago

CHICAGO - The Mount Mercy University volleyball team squared its record at 5-5 Friday by capturing two matches at the Chicago State Tournament.

The Mustangs swept Indiana-Northwest, 25-9, 25-13, 25-13, and trimmed Trinity International, 25-13, 21-25, 25-23, 25-20.

Megan Paustian led a balanced attack against Indiana Northwest with 12 kills. Cori Peterzalek had nine kills, Emma Pisarik eight kills and Leslie Hoffmann seven kills.

Abbie Perez collected 31 assists against Indiana Northwest. Peterzalek had 13 digs and Samantha Meyer had nine digs.

Peterzalek led the way against Trinity with 12 kills. Hoffmann had 10 kills, Paustian eight and Demi Heiss eight.

Perez contributed 19 assists against Trinity. Emily Hendrickson had 15 assists and Meyer had 10. Hannah Whitley had 16 digs and Perez had 12 digs.

Young Mustangs fall short to Ashford

Megan Paustian got a taste of college volleyball during her one semester at Kirkwood last year, but even that limited experience has helped her take a leadership role with the young team at Mount Mercy University this season.

The Mustangs used four freshmen, four sophomores and a junior in their nine-player rotation Wednesday night during a 25-27, 25-12, 25-14, 25-18 loss to Ashford University in a non-conference match at the Hennessey Recreation Center.

Paustian, a sophomore, spent one semester at Kirkwood and one semester at Scott Community College before enrolling at Mount Mercy this year.

"I'm not a captain, but I find myself talking a lot in the huddles and talking a lot on the court and just getting the girls pumped up," said Paustian, a 5-foot-11 outside hitter who starred in high school at Pleasant Valley.

Mount Mercy spikers drop 2 matches

PALOS HEIGHTS, Ill. - The Mount Mercy volleyball team dropped a pair of touch matches at the St.Xavier/Trinity Christian Crossover Tournament in Palos Heights Saturday.

Lourdes rallied to defeat the Mustangs, 20-25, 24-26, 25-20, 25-22, 15-10 in their first match. Siena Heights trimmed the Mustangs, 27-25, 24-26, 25-19, 25-19 in the second contest.

Mount Mercy's record fell to 3-4 for the season.

Demi Heiss had 16 kills in the match against Lourdes. Ashley Strong collected 25 assists. Cori Peterzalek had 20 digs. Leslie Hoffmann contributed eight blocks.

The individual statistics from the Siena Heights match were not available Saturday night.

Mustangs split 2 volleyball matches

CHICAGO - The Mount Mercy University volleyball team split two matches at the St.Xavier/Trinity Christian Crossover Tournament in Chicago Friday.

The Mustangs lost to Roosevelt (Ill.), 25-22, 25-23, 25-19, but rebounded with a 20-25, 26-24, 25-22, 25-18 victory over Spring Arbor (Mich.).

Megan Paustian had 12 kills for the Mustangs against Roosevelt. Samantha Meyer had 15 digs. Abbie Perez collected 17 assists.

Rebekah Kujat finished with 18 kills against Spring Arbor. Gabrielle Hilliard had 22 assists. Lyndsay Murray had 15 digs.

Mount Mercy has a 3-2 record.
